edaphology
noun
- soil science
- study of the influence of soils on living things, particularly plants

noun
Etymology: From Ancient Greek ἔδαφος (édaphos, “ground”) + -logy. By surface analysis, edapho- + log + -y or edaph- + -olog + -y or edaph- + -o- + log + -y.
- The ecological relationship of soil with plants, and land cultivation practices.
